Sheffield United have had two players ruled out for the rest of the season with Jayden Bogle and David McGoldrick both requiring operations.
Young defender Jayden Bogle is expected to be for approximately six months after having undergone knee surgery. Meanwhile, David McGoldrick has picked up a thigh injury that will also require an operation.
The news comes just two weeks after Rhian Brewster picked up a hamstring injury that also required surgery and cut the 21-year old’s season short.
Despite the injuries, Paul Heckingbottom’s have been in good form lately and won 4-0 against Swansea City last weekend. The Blades are currently sixth in the Championship table.
